speculation   n. 推测;投机

  • She dismissed the newspaper reports as pure speculation. 她将报纸报道斥为纯粹的猜测
  • There has been a great deal of speculation about what will happen after the elections. 对于选举后将发生什么有大量的猜测(speculation about … 对于…的猜测)
  • The bank warned against excessive speculation in property development. 银行警告不要过度投机于房地产开发。 (speculation in … 在某方面的投机)
speculate on/about … 猜测…的原因 (v.)We can only speculate on/about the reasons for his sudden resignation. 我们只能猜测他突然辞职的原因。
speculate in … 在…方面投机 (v.)He speculated in stocks, hoping to make a quick profit. 他在股票上投机,希望快速获利。
speculative 猜测的;推测性的 (adj.)
speculative investments 投机性投资 (adj.)Financial advisors usually recommend avoiding highly speculative investments. 财务顾问通常建议避免高度投机性的投资。
conjecture 推测;猜测 (n. 强调基于不完整信息)The article was full of conjecture regarding the singer's private life. 这篇文章充满了关于这位歌手私生活的推测。
guesswork/guess work 猜测;推测 (n. 强调随机或缺乏事实)We don't need evidence-based results; this is all just guesswork. 我们不需要基于证据的结果,这一切都只是猜测。
